Smylie Kaufman and Charlie Hulme recap moving day at Oakmont, which began in the rain and concluded with Smylie's fellow LSU Tiger, Sam Burns, sleeping on the lead once again at the 2025 U.S. Open.

Smylie witnessed Adam Scott's round-of-the-day 67 firsthand on the NBC broadcast, and breaks down what the Australian will need to do Sunday to become the second-oldest U.S. Open winner and add a second major to his trophy case.

SK and CH also discuss the days that Viktor Hovland and JJ Spaun had - both near the top of the leaderboard, but a shot further off after bogeying 18 to finish their respective days.

Smylie Kaufman and Charlie Hulme recap a thrilling finish to the 124th U.S. Open live on both YouTube and X, with Bryson DeChambeau winning by a shot thanks to an incredible up-and-down on the 72nd hole, while Rory McIlroy came up agonizingly short. Smylie and Charlie take comments from the chat ranging from Bryson's legacy now that he has two major wins, Rory's abrupt exit after coming up short, and the type of game it takes to win a major, and how that differs depending on the venue and setup.
